要求100到1000之间的所有素数之和,您可以使用编程语言来计算。以下是一个示例使用Python编程语言的代码来实现这个任务: def is_prime(num): if num < 2: return False for i in range(2, int(num ** 0.5) + 1): if num % i == 0: return False return True sum_of_primes = 0 for num in rang...
解题思路:需要实现两个函数,一个是判断数字是否是素数;一个是求和函数。实现函数,判断是否是素数,is_prime,具体代码如下:def is_prime(num):"""判断是否是素数.:param num::return:"""result = True 质数大于 1 if num > 1:查看因子 for i in range(2, num):if (num % i) == 0...
2. 遍历1到1000的整数并找出素数 现在我们可以使用上面定义的is_prime函数来遍历1到1000之间的所有整数,找出素数了。 primes=[]# 用于存储素数的列表fornuminrange(1,1001):# 遍历1到1000ifis_prime(num):# 调用is_prime函数检查num是否为素数primes.append(num)# 如果是素数,将其添加到列表中 1. 2. 3. ...
print(find_primes(1, 100)) 这个函数接受两个参数:起始值和结束值,然后使用is_prime函数来检查范围内的每个数字是否为素数。如果是,则将其添加到primes列表中。最后,函数返回包含所有素数的列表。在这个例子中,我们找出1至100之间的所有素数,并打印结果。输出应该如下所示: [2, 3, 5, 7, 11, 13, 17, 19...
!/usr/bin/python -*- coding: UTF-8 -*- b = 0 for a in range(1,100):k = 0 for i in range(2,a):if a % i == 0 :k += 1 if k == 0 :print a b +=1 print "素数一共有",b,"个"素数:一个数只能被1 和它本身整除,则该数即为素数 ...
本文主要演示Python求1-100之间有多少个素数。工具/原料 windows系统电脑1台 提前安装好pycharm社区免费版 方法/步骤 1 打开桌面的pycharm程序;2 依次点击 file > New Project 新建一个代码目录;3 依次点击 New > Python File 新建一个python文件;4 输入名为“100_zhishu”的程序并点击保存;5 如图示...
python每日一练, 视频播放量 0、弹幕量 0、点赞数 0、投硬币枚数 0、收藏人数 0、转发人数 0, 视频作者 苦修_两年半, 作者简介 ,相关视频:
求100以内的素数primes = []for n in range(2,101): for i in range(2,int(n**(1/2))+1): if n % i == 0: break else: primes += [n]print(primes)print(f'100内有{len(primes)}个素数')程序缩进如图所示 ...
Python求1到200之间所有素数 在计算机编程和数学中,素数(又称质数)是一个重要的概念。素数是指大于1的自然数,且只能被1和其自身整除的数。例如,2、3、5、7、11和13都是素数,而4、6、8、9和10则不是。本文将介绍如何使用Python编程语言来查找1到200之间的所有素数,并将代码示例呈现出来。
1、新建python文件,testprimenum.py;2、编写python代码,求1到100之间的素数;list1 = []i = 2 for i in range(2,101):j = 2 for j in range (2,i):if i%j == 0:break else:list1.append(i)print(list1)3、窗口中右击,选择‘在终端中运行Python文件’;4、查看执行结果,1-...